How they compare

Pakistan currently reports 81.03 million kg against 79.01 million kg in Brazil, a difference of 2.02 million kg.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Brazil ahead.

Brazil ranks 9th and Pakistan ranks 8th of 190 countries.

Brazil has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Brazil Pakistan Difference Ahead
1960s 42.40 million kg 10.10 million kg 32.31 million kg Brazil
1970s 59.71 million kg 11.97 million kg 47.74 million kg Brazil
1980s 86.54 million kg 15.99 million kg 70.55 million kg Brazil
1990s 94.95 million kg 25.64 million kg 69.31 million kg Brazil
2000s 101.46 million kg 39.54 million kg 61.92 million kg Brazil
2010s 103.50 million kg 59.50 million kg 44.00 million kg Brazil
2020s 79.70 million kg 76.72 million kg 2.98 million kg Brazil

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
